Inspection/Report History

Where possible, ChildcareCenter provides inspection reports as a service to families. This information is deemed reliable but is not guaranteed. We encourage families to contact the daycare provider directly with any questions or concerns. Reports can also be verified with your local daycare licensing office.

Date Type Regulations Status
2023-05-01 Conversion 13A.18.03.02A Corrected
Findings: A child was in care without a health inventory (parents and medical portion of health inventory). Please submit a copy of information to OCC.
2023-05-01 Conversion 13A.18.03.04C Corrected
Findings: A child was missing the doctors information on emergency card. Please submit a correction plan to OCC.
2023-05-01 Conversion 13A.18.03.04E Corrected
Findings: Six children did not have lead screenings in their files. Please submit copies of the lead screenings to OCC.
2023-05-01 Conversion 13A.18.09.04A(4)(a) Corrected
Findings: A pack and play had a regular size sheet that was not tight fitting. Please correct immediately and submit documentation to OCC.
2023-01-06 Other 13A.18.07.06A Corrected
Findings: An individual was on site that had access and was assigned to a group of children that has not been cleared by the Office of Child Care. The individual has been printed but the prints were not received at the Office of Child Care and the director did not have a completed notarized release.
2022-11-09 Other 13A.18.08.01A(2)(b) Corrected
Findings: At time of inspection the second staff member was outside by his car when specialist arrived. The program had nine children on site. Please submit a correction plan to OCC.
2022-11-09 Other 13A.18.08.03E Corrected
Findings: The program had 2 children under the age of 24 months, 4 two year old's and, 3 three year old's. The director was inside at time of inspection, the second teacher was outside by the garage when arrived at the home. Please submit a correction plan to occ.
2022-11-03 Mandatory Review 13A.18.03.04C Corrected
Findings: An emergency card was missing authorized pick up. An emergency card was missing doctors information. Please submit copies of corrected emergency cards.
2022-11-03 Mandatory Review 13A.18.06.06D(1) Corrected
Findings: The teacher had no training on site at time of inspection. Please submit a correction plan to OCC.
2022-11-03 Mandatory Review 13A.18.08.01A(2)(b) Corrected
Findings: A three year old was in the childcare area without adult supervision. Please submit a correction plan to OCC.
2022-11-03 Mandatory Review 13A.18.08.02B Corrected
Findings: The specialist observed eight children were on playground with the aide. Please submit a correction plan to oCC.
2022-11-03 Mandatory Review 13A.18.08.03E Corrected
Findings: The program had 2 infants, one toddler, 3 two year olds, 1 three year old, and 1 four year were on playground with the aide at time of inspection. The provider met with the specialist in the home and her three year old son remained in the house with provider. The husband, classroom teacher went outside with the aide at time of inspection.
2022-11-03 Mandatory Review 13A.18.10.04A Corrected
Findings: Bug Spray, diaper creams were in cubbies at time of inspection. Please submit a correction plan to OCC.
2022-03-28 Mandatory Review 13A.18.03.04C Corrected
Findings: Specialist observed three emergency forms missing the child's physicians information. Provider shall submit a letter of correction.
2020-07-23 Mandatory Review
Findings: No Noncompliances Found
